Puberty is a challenging time for both children and parents. Many researches about parenting in puberty time have been done in the western culture context. Due to Chinese parents' special philosophy of parenting, it is valuable and interesting to probe the this parenting-related issue in Chinese context. Unfortunately, there was few study to do so. As the supplement for previous research, this study aimed to discuss Chinese parenting behaviors during children's early adolescent time by introducing two interviews with a parent of early adolescent boy and a parent of a girl in early adolescence respectively. It's found that the Chinese parenting style can be explained from 3 aspects: aims of parenting, basic idea of parenting, expectations to kid. No matter for boy or girl, the parenting involves supervision and understanding and love, which is a kind of unique style shared in Chinese family education culture. Besides, parent gives more expectation about parent-child communication to girl.

The history of studying autoaggressive behavior model and cognitive rigidity is quite extensive and diverse. Nevertheless, the relevance of studying the problem of autoaggression among adolescents has increased significantly in recent decades. Self-harming and self-destructive behavior has become a fashion trend among the younger generation. The aim of the research is studying of features cognitive rigidity in adolescence with a tendency to autoregressive behavior model. the study involved 65 students of secondary school aged 14-15 years (M=14,4; SD=0,8). The following methods were used: «Tendencies to deviant behavior» (A.N. Orel), The Stroop Color and Word Test, besides statistical techniques (descriptive statistics, Mann Whitney U test, Spearman rank correlation coefficient). As the result of the research it was proved that adolescents who are prone to autoaggressive behavior model, the level of cognitive rigidity is higher, in comparison with adolescents who are not inclined to self-destructive behavior. There was also discovered a positive relationship between the degree of propensity for autoaggressive behavior model and the level of cognitive rigidity. The prospects of the research cover the study of the personal characteristics of children and parents, the styles of family education that contribute to the formation and development of cognitive rigidity, the tendency to auto-aggressive behavior. The results of the research can be used in the organization of psychological and pedagogical support of adolescents and their families.
